A fast-growing brush fire is forcing thousands of people to evacuate in a mountainous area north of Los Angeles.
LOS ANGELES — Firefighters in a mountainous area north of Los Angeles made good progress in their battle against a brush fire that has forced thousands of people to evacuate, officials said Friday.
